具有 ALB、Web 和应用程序服务器的 ECS
ECS with ALB, web and application Server
我有一个面向 Internet 的 Application Load Balancer 设置和 ECS 容器服务设置,其中包含 Auto Scaling 组和 AWS 中的 2 个私有子网。我想用 Nginx 安装 Nexus。最好的策略是什么,以便我可以充分利用所有这些服务?
我假设你想部署 Nginx 作为 Nexus 前面的反向代理。如果是这样,AWS 的以下参考架构应该有所帮助:
https://github.com/awslabs/ecs-nginx-reverse-proxy/tree/master/reverse-proxy
它展示了如何创建一个具有两个相互链接的任务的任务定义,以便 nginx 反向代理容器可以位于您的应用程序前面并向其发送流量。
我有一个面向 Internet 的 Application Load Balancer 设置和 ECS 容器服务设置,其中包含 Auto Scaling 组和 AWS 中的 2 个私有子网。我想用 Nginx 安装 Nexus。最好的策略是什么,以便我可以充分利用所有这些服务?
我假设你想部署 Nginx 作为 Nexus 前面的反向代理。如果是这样,AWS 的以下参考架构应该有所帮助:
https://github.com/awslabs/ecs-nginx-reverse-proxy/tree/master/reverse-proxy
它展示了如何创建一个具有两个相互链接的任务的任务定义,以便 nginx 反向代理容器可以位于您的应用程序前面并向其发送流量。